#0b0189 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b0189 is composed of 4.3% red, 0.4%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 244.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 27.1%. #0b0189 color hex could be obtained by blending #1602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0b0189 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b0189 has RGB values of R:11, G:1,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 721289.

Shades and Tints of #0b0189
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eeecff is the lightest one.
